Muriel Leask (nee Norman)

January 21, 1916 – June 26, 2015

 

Muriel passed away peacefully at Cottonwoods in Kelowna at the age of 99.

 She was predeceased by her husband Cameron, daughter Jean and her son-in-law Richard, her brother Charles, and sister Evelyn.  She is survived by her brother John, daughter Lorna (Ian), son Ian (Jane), and son Jim (Teresa), her grandchildren David, Robin, Andrew, Jessica, Christopher, Colin, Kelly and Kate, and her great grandchildren Tabitha, Griffin, Harrison and Tessa.

Muriel grew up in Prince Albert, graduated from the Royal Conservatory of Music in Toronto, lived in Saskatoon and then travelled the world supporting the work of Cameron, a CIDA consultant.  She retired on Salt Spring Island and in Kelowna.  The world is a richer place as she taught numerous students to play the piano and through her community work with Girl Guides of Canada, Order of the Eastern Star, Daughters of the Nile, UCWA, various Community Clubs, and a life time of memberships in choirs and choral groups.
